In my example, I have 3 stages for JSM

Each of these are tagged with a custom trigger that applies to more than one policy in JAMF. This allows me to add/remove items from the installation process without having to modify the configuration profile.

It would be good if/when a technician is sitting at a device to be able to see 'under the hood' a bit more as to whats going on in the background.
Maybe even using an alternative combo like Shift+CMD+L ?

This would help when testing/debugging issues with live devices without having to otherwise gain access to a device via ssh or similar during setup.
